![]() The Lost HeartA Poem by A. Kim Spradling![]() "Sometimes things get lost along the way"![]() My heart lies in a place I can no longer be. I’m sailing a ship On a dry empty sea. My spirit is now barren Where the heart filled my chest. Days are spent drowning On a fool hearted quest. Why can’t I feel the passion Or excitement of devotion? My soul remains detached And devoid of emotion! There are feelings inside, They are so hard to trust. This physical yearning For unspeakable lust. So, I’ll take a chance On this unforeseen course. Seemly moved by This veiled boundless force. Will time soon replace, My leather bound heart? A leap of faith, now ready For this unthinkable start. © 2018 A. Kim SpradlingReviews
